There are 3 ways to accomplish the Infinite Tsukuyomi.
1) Become the Juubi Jin and open the flower of the Shinju at the moon.
2) Obtain the Dual Rinnegan and get close to the moon to cast IT.
3) Eat the Holy Fruit and use it.
Clearly Madara preferred his method over Obito's. Why? There seems to be a difference.
I suspect that as I go down the list, the technique becomes more potent. with 1) being the weakest and 3) being the strongest.
They are all powered by different things.
Obito's Infinite Tsukuyomi is powered by the Shinju.
Madara's Infinite Tsukuyomi is powered by the Rinnegan.
Kaguya's is powered by the Fruit.
In terms of power. Fruit>Rinnegan>Tree.
Here's a caveat:
Now, as I've stated in my other thread, Madara's method and Obito's method uses the Moon. It is seems Kaguya's method utilizes does not use the moon.
Madara's method is similar to Kaguya in the it uses the third eye, put it only opens by getting close to the moon.
Rinnegan can create the moon so clearly CT is built for the purpose of Infinite Tsukuyomi.
But here lies the contradiction. It seems like Obito's method requires the Rinnegan( indirectly of course) because there needs to be a moon there in the first place. Without someone using the Rinnegan to create the moon, Obito's method wouldn't work at all.
I suspect that the main method of combining all chakra via the Fruit was Kaguya's method. This is the most potent one. One that seemingly does not require the moon.
But if Fruit's method fails, there is a backup plan. The Rinnegan. It allows those who ate the fruit to have a child born with the Rinnegan, in hopes of it keeping the plan, or it's descendents to keep the plan.
But the Rinnegan way, being less potent than the fruit, needs an object of reflection: Moon. Therefore, it is no coincidence that the only way of keeping the Gedo Mazou at bay is with Chibaku Tensei, it indirectly forced Hagaromo into creating the moon for Kaguya's plans.
If the Rinnegan method of casting IT fails, then at the very least, the Rinnegan user would have retreived the Gedo Mazou. This would enable a Juubi Jin to cast IT, as the Rinnegan already did much of the work: creating the moon, unsealing the Mazou etc.
In conclusion:
There are 3 ways of IT: Fruit, Rinnegan, and Juubi Jin, in descending order of potency.
The Fruit method was the most original. If that fails, the Rinnegan would build off where the Fruit method left off. If that one fails as well, the Juubi Jin method would pick up where the Rinnegan method failed.
